How they compare
Egypt currently reports 416.66 base year varies by country against 404.23 base year varies by country in Guinea, a difference of 12.43 base year varies by country.
Across all 26 years both countries report, Egypt has been ahead every year.
Egypt ranks 12th and Guinea ranks 13th of 52 countries.
Egypt has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The GDP implicit deflator is the ratio of GDP in current local currency to GDP in constant local currency. The base year varies by country.
